Bureaucrats Quote by Tommy Tuberville
“Unelected bureaucrats should not have the ability to direct settlement funds to progressive organizations under the guise of 'donations,' especially when these groups could turn right around and use that money to put pressure on members of Congress to vote with their agenda.”
About This Quote
Critique of unelected officials using settlement money as donations to influence political agendas, warning of misuse.
In simple terms: Unelected officials should not redirect funds for political leverage.
